CC -!- FUNCTION: Catalyzes two non-sequential steps in de novo AMP synthesis:
CC converts (S)-2-(5-amino-1-(5-phospho-D-ribosyl)imidazole-4-
CC carboxamido)succinate (SAICAR) to fumarate plus 5-amino-1-(5-phospho-D-
CC ribosyl)imidazole-4-carboxamide, and thereby also contributes to de
CC novo IMP synthesis, and converts succinyladenosine monophosphate (SAMP)
CC to AMP and fumarate. {ECO:0000256|ARBA:ARBA00002971}.
